American Music Awards: J-Lo falls flat at the AMAs J-Lo provided one of the unintentional highlights of the American Music Awards when she fell over on stage in the middle of her dance routine. After tons of advance hype, J-Lo's performance of "Louboutins" fell flat -- and so did the singer. She took a tumble mid-song. In her defense, the song wasn't completely awful, but its advance hype gave viewers high expectations. Most of us were a little underwhelmed. The star otherwise known as Jennifer Lopez landed on her famous behind mid-way through her performance of Louboutins. She had climbed on to the back of a male dancer and jumped off, only to slip as she landed. Ever the professional, she quickly recovered her composure but was later filmed looking furious as she exited the auditorium. It had all started so well, with the singer entering the arena dressed as a prizefighter for a boxing-inspired performance. Afterwards, her spokesman reassured fans that Lopez had not been injured in the fall. "She's fine, totally fine," he said. Lopez was not the only star to take a tumble at the ceremony. Adam Lambert, the former American Idol star, also slipped mid-way through his routine. However, that was the least noteworthy element of his performance, which was so risque that it provoked furious complaints from viewers who felt it was too graphic for a primetime audience. Other performers at the ceremony included Rihanna, Lady GaGa and Whitney Houston. Los Angeles, California (November 22, 2009)- Winners of the 37th annual American Music Awards (AMAs) were announced this evening to a sold out crowd, from the Nokia Theatre/LA Live. The show aired live on ABC at 8:00pm ET/ 7:00pm CT. Prior to the awards ceremony, there was a two-hour online red carpet show that streamed live on ABC.com, Facebook.com/celebs, Ustream.tv, and mycokerewards.com along with numerous other sites. The AMA Red Carpet Pre-Show set a new Ustream record for the largest red carpet webcast and farthest-reaching event on the leading internet broadcasting platform. The webcast achieved more than 3 million total views (Total viewers: 3.3 million / Total uniques: 2.1 million) during the 2 hour live event. Produced by dick clark productions, The 2009 AMAs were produced by Larry Klein and executive produced by Orly Adelson, president of dick clark productions. Highlights of the event included: Stellar live performances from Lady Gaga, Rihanna, Jennifer Lopez and an 8 minute opening medley by Janet Jackson featuring Control, What Have You Done for Me Lately, Make Me, Together Again and more. The night also marked Whitney Houstons return to stage singing I Didnt Know My Own Strength, Eminem and 50 Cent performing Crack a Bottle and the finale with Adam Lamberts first live television show since American Idol. Winners of the 37th Annual American Music Awards included Taylor Swift taking home 5 awards including Artist of The Year, Michael Jackson honored with 4 awards including Favorite Male Artist (Pop/Rock), Jay-Z sweeping the Rap / Hip Hop category with 2 awards, Green Day winning Favorite Artist (Alternative Rock Music) and more. A complete list of winners is attached. Music fans were able to vote for the T-Mobile Breakthrough Artist Award and selected Gloriana as this years Breakthrough Artist.
